54 providers in Interventional Cardiology, Spinal Cord Injury (SCI) Medicine, Surgical Critical Care, Vascular Neurology (stroke)

54 providers in Interventional Cardiology, Spinal Cord Injury (SCI) Medicine, Surgical Critical Care, Vascular Neurology (stroke)